Troubleshooting Common Issues with Your Bambu Lab 3D Printer
Experiencing problems with your Bambu Lab printer ? Don't fret – many owners encounter common challenges . A unexpected clogging in the nozzle is frequently the first sign of a possible issue , easily fixed by a cold pull or using the nozzle method . Similarly, failed layer to the build plate can be due to an low bed setting , a unclean build surface, or an flawed initial layer depth. Finally, unpredictable motions might suggest a disconnected belt, a calibration error , or a system bug .
